▌ Naval Architecture Naval Architecture is a branch of engineering that deals with design, construction, operation, repair, maintenance and certification of marine vehicles including surface ships, submarines and deep submersibles. ▌ Petroleum Engineering The Petroleum Engineering (PE) program at IIT Madras focuses on upstream activities of petroleum exploration and production with a strong emphasis on reservoir characterization through modelling as well as experimental studies.
